Bollywood’s brightest stars descended on the Bvlgari Serpenti Infinito exhibition at the Nita Mukesh Ambani Cultural Centre (NMACC) in Mumbai, dressed to the nines and shimmering in the brand’s signature jewels. From Priyanka Chopra, Nita Ambani, and Isha Ambani to Tamannaah Bhatia, Manushi Chhillar, Khushi Kapoor, and more — the guest list read like a who’s who of glamour. Each celebrity brought their own interpretation of elegance, pairing carefully curated couture with striking pieces from Bvlgari’s iconic collection.

Among them, Mrunal Thakur stood out as a true vision of modern sophistication. Taking to Instagram with the caption “An art dream 🫶🏻 @bvlgari @nmacc.india”, the actress showcased a look that was both sculptural and sensual — perfectly complementing the art-inspired atmosphere of the exhibition.

Her ensemble was anchored by a strapless black gown, its corset-style bodice cinching her frame with architectural precision. Subtle paneling enhanced her waistline, while the fluid skirt and thigh-high slit introduced drama and movement. Minimal yet impactful, the silhouette let her presence do the talking, creating a mood of effortless grace.

Accessories elevated the look into the realm of art. Mrunal wore Bvlgari’s Serpenti watch in gleaming gold, stacked with matching bangles that echoed the maison’s legacy of sensuality and power. The serpentine motif resonated perfectly against the exhibition’s mirrored installation — an interplay of reflections and symbolism. A micro beaded clutch in black, with its curved handle, added a modern flourish while keeping the focus on her jewels.

Her beauty choices leaned into understated glamour. Flowing waves framed her face softly, a natural counterpoint to the gown’s sharp structure. A dewy base, brushed-up brows, and subtle contouring brought out her natural radiance, while muted pink lips and defined eyes created balance without overpowering the overall look.

Poised against the immersive backdrop of the Serpenti Infinito exhibition, Mrunal embodied her caption: an art dream. She was not merely attending an event but curating a moment where fashion, jewellery, and art merged into one.

With her black gown, statement jewellery, and effortless aura, Mrunal Thakur delivered a look that captured both the timeless elegance of Bvlgari and the contemporary boldness of Indian cinema’s new generation of style icons.
